Here is something that puzzles me but is totally trivial.
If you want to watch the BBC's iPlayer you need to have an account. If you want to do it legally you need to have a licence. It would seem trivial for the BBC to require you to link a license to your account. Presumably you have a database linking licence numbers to names and addresses with license numbers. Instead they don't. When I signed up, I could use a non existent email address, name and physical address. I'm happy about that. Why don't that make it a bit harder to cheat the system?
